Coupling symmetries with Poisson structures

open access: yes, 2012
We study local normal forms for completely integrable systems on Poisson manifolds in the presence of additional symmetries. The symmetries that we consider are encoded in actions of compact Lie groups.

Integrable structure of box-ball systems: crystal, Bethe ansatz, ultradiscretization and tropical geometry

open access: yes, 2012
The box-ball system is an integrable cellular automaton on one dimensional lattice. It arises from either quantum or classical integrable systems by the procedures called crystallization and ultradiscretization, respectively.
